我正在做一个秒表,我使用Java的SimpleDateFormat将毫秒数转换为一个不错的“hh:mm:ss:SSS”格式。问题是小时字段中总是有一些随机数。这是我正在使用的代码:publicstaticStringformatTime(longmillis){SimpleDateFormatsdf=newSimpleDateFormat("hh:mm:ss.SSS");StringstrDate=sdf.format(millis);returnstrDate;}如果我取下hh部分,那么它工作正常。否则,即使传入的参数(毫秒数)为零,它也会在hh部分显示像“07”这样的随机内容。不过
我正在尝试将yyyy-MM-dd'T'HH:mm:ss.SSSz格式的日期格式化为yyyy-mm-ddHH:mm:ss,这应该很容易,但我无法获得它可以工作。需要解析的日期格式为:2012-10-01T09:45:00.000+02:00现在我使用这个简单的日期格式化程序来格式化它:SimpleDateFormatsdf=newSimpleDateFormat("yyyy-MM-dd'T'HH:mm:ss.SSSz",Locale.FRANCE);然而这给出了类似于2012-10-01T09:45:00.000UTC+00:00的输出。我也尝试使用“yyyy-MM-dd'T'HH:mm
kk:mm、HH:mm和hh:mm格式有什么区别??SimpleDateFormatbroken=newSimpleDateFormat("kk:mm:ss");broken.setTimeZone(TimeZone.getTimeZone("Etc/UTC"));SimpleDateFormatworking=newSimpleDateFormat("HH:mm:ss");working.setTimeZone(TimeZone.getTimeZone("Etc/UTC"));SimpleDateFormatworking2=newSimpleDateFormat("hh:mm:ss
我正在尝试使用JavaScript将日期对象转换为有效的MySQL日期-最好的方法是什么? 最佳答案 获取日期:constdate=newDate().toJSON().slice(0,10)console.log(date)//2015-07-23对于日期时间:constdatetime=newDate().toJSON().slice(0,19).replace('T','')console.log(datetime)//2015-07-2311:26:00请注意,生成的日期/日期时间将始终采用UTC时区。
我正在尝试将DateTime格式转换为yyyy-MM-dd格式并将其存储到DateTime对象。但它给了我系统DateTime格式,即MM/dd/yyyy。我正在使用以下代码进行转换。stringdateTime=DateTime.Now.ToString();stringcreateddate=Convert.ToDateTime(dateTime).ToString("yyyy-MM-ddh:mmtt");DateTimedt=DateTime.ParseExact(createddate,"yyyy-MM-ddh:mmtt",CultureInfo.InvariantCultur
通过使用这个:Text(newDateTime.fromMillisecondsSinceEpoch(values[index]["start_time"]*1000).toString(),我得到了图片中附加的格式类型,但是我想知道是否可以在dd/MM/YYYYhh:mm中得到它?? 最佳答案 如果您使用intlpackagefinalf=newDateFormat('yyyy-MM-ddhh:mm');Text(f.format(newDateTime.fromMillisecondsSinceEpoch(values[inde
如何使用JavaScript将秒转换为HH-MM-SS字符串? 最佳答案 您可以在没有任何外部JavaScript库的情况下借助JavaScriptDate方法做到这一点,如下所示:vardate=newDate(null);date.setSeconds(SECONDS);//specifyvalueforSECONDSherevarresult=date.toISOString().substr(11,8);或者,根据@Frank的评论;一个类轮:newDate(SECONDS*1000).toISOString().subst
使用NodeJS,我想将Date格式化为以下字符串格式:varts_hms=newDate(UTC);ts_hms.format("%Y-%m-%d%H:%M:%S");我该怎么做? 最佳答案 如果你使用Node.js,你肯定有EcmaScript5,所以Date有一个toISOString方法。您要求对ISO8601稍作修改:newDate().toISOString()>'2012-11-04T14:51:06.157Z'所以只要删掉一些东西,就可以了:newDate().toISOString().replace(/T/,''
我正在尝试将JSON数据中的对象反序列化为C#类(我使用的是NewtonsoftJson.NET)。数据包含日期为字符串值,如09/12/2013其中格式为dd/MM/yyyy.如果我调用JsonConvert.DeserializeObject(data),日期加载到DateTime带有MM/dd/yyyy的C#类的属性格式,这会导致日期值为12September2013(而不是9December2013)。是否可以配置JsonConvert获取正确格式的日期? 最佳答案 您可以使用IsoDateTimeConverter并指定D
如果您在网上查找如何将整个磁盘克隆到另一个磁盘,您会发现类似的内容:ddif=/dev/sdaof=/dev/sdbconv=notrunc,noerror虽然我理解noerror,但我很难理解为什么人们认为“数据完整性”需要notrunc(如ArchLinux'sWiki所述,对于实例)。确实,如果您将一个分区复制到另一个磁盘上的另一个分区,并且您不想覆盖整个磁盘,只覆盖一个分区,我确实同意这一点。在这种情况下,根据dd的手册页,notrunc就是您想要的。但是,如果您要克隆整个磁盘,notrunc会为您改变什么?只是时间优化? 最佳答案